Proposed Mara Hospital to Serve All Malaysians Regardless of Ethnicity

Mara's leadership has moved to address concerns about accessibility for the proposed hospital project, emphasising that the facility would serve the entire Malaysian population without regard to ethnic background.

The chairman outlined plans for the hospital to operate as a comprehensive medical institution catering to diverse patient demographics across the country. Beyond its primary function as a healthcare facility, the hospital would support medical education by serving as a teaching institution for students pursuing medical degrees.

The announcement underscores Mara's commitment to contributing to Malaysia's healthcare infrastructure while maintaining inclusive access principles. The proposed facility would complement existing medical institutions and provide additional capacity within the nation's healthcare system.

Details regarding the hospital's location, funding, timeline, and specific specialities remain subject to further development and planning stages. The project represents an expansion of Mara's institutional portfolio beyond its traditional focus areas.
